I have a Nikon D60, I like it a lot. Except it doesnt have a bracketing function (With some cameras you can take 3 images in one go and it will give you 3 different exposures to ensure you get a correct one)
It makes up for it with the RAW formatting function, so you can adjust the exposure after you've photographed.

Canon for me too. I upgraded from the 300D last year to the 40D. I also have a Canon Ixus compact for every day use which I love to bits.

Check out dpreview if you want to compare specs etc.

What I did when I upgraded was to wait for the new Canon to come out then bought the outgoing model much cheaper. I am not a pixel junkie, 10mp was plenty for me, no need for the 15mp they were introducing, and I saved me nearly $1,000 on the deal.
